What you will be doing

The Preventative Maintenance Engineer is responsible for successfully maintaining and repairing cosmetic items and mechanical equipment in hotel rooms and public spaces. Responsibilities include performing various work order tasks and assisting with guest service calls.

The ideal candidate for this position will have the following

QUALIFICATIONS: EDUCATION, KNOWLEDGE, TRAINING, & WORK EXPERIENCE

High school diploma or equivalent.
1-year experience in a similar job or in the hospitality industry is preferred.
Ability to use hand tools and power tools.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ONSMaintains all mechanical and cosmetic items in the hotel aligned with the hotel's preventative maintenance schedule.
Assists engineering staff in repairs when necessary.
Maintains a neat, clean, and organized work area in the engineering shop.
Prepares daily work forms.
Routinely inspects all lighting throughout the hotel, identifying potential problems and resolving them.
Responds to maintenance requests and house calls.
Ensures a maximum level of service and satisfaction is achieved and maintained.
Maintains a working knowledge and understanding of all rules, regulations and controls of the company.
Responsible for correct use of office equipment, EMS system, and Life Safety Systems (training provided).
